Appian Operator Release Notes

Overview

This page documents the release notes for each version of the Appian operator that is released for self-managed customers.

Note:  Only the three most recent releases of the Appian operator are supported at any given time. Users should upgrade the operator frequently to stay up-to-date with bug and security fixes, especially since upgrading the operator neither requires upgrading installations of Appian on Kubernetes nor impacts their availability.

v0.146.1

Kubernetes Compatibility

We support Kubernetes versions 1.23-1.27 for this release.

New Features

  • The Appian operator Helm chart now includes a hook that installs or upgrades the Appian custom resource definition (CRD). Customers no longer have to annotate or patch the Appian CRD after installing or upgrading the Appian operator or upgrade it before upgrading the operator. As part of this change, a new Helm chart value, .webhooks.caBundle, has been added to replace the old, now deprecated .webhooks.webhookConfiguration.caBundle value.
  • The Appian operator Helm chart can now be pulled from Appian's container registry instead of downloaded from Appian Community. For more information, see Appian operator Helm chart
  • The operator now sets stateful sets' update strategies to RollingUpdate if they have multiple replicas. This means that customers no longer have to manually delete pods after making certain changes to Appian custom resources.

v0.117.0

Kubernetes Compatibility

We support Kubernetes versions 1.21-1.25 for this release.

New Features

  • Added version printer column to Appians resources. When running kubectl get appians in terminal, the Appian version is now printed if it was set in the Appian custom resource.

  • Updated all statefulset update strategies to OnDelete. From Kubernetes documentation: "When a StatefulSet's .spec.updateStrategy.type is set to OnDelete, the StatefulSet controller will not automatically update the Pods in a StatefulSet. Users must manually delete Pods to cause the controller to create new Pods that reflect modifications made to a StatefulSet's .spec.template."

  • Created a new field in the CRD for the Appian version in .spec.version. While the field is currently optional, we recommend customers start setting the field in their custom resources as the field will become required in the future. The operator will now understand the version of Appian a site is running on and in the future could perform different actions based on the version. If .spec.version is set, customers can omit the .spec.<component>.image.tag fields from their custom resources, as they will get automatically populated with the version.

Note:  This operator release supports Kubernetes version 1.25, and 1.19 and 1.20 are now deprecated.

v0.108.0

Kubernetes Compatibility

We support Kubernetes versions 1.19-1.24 for this release.

New Features

  • Added conversion webhooks to allow for versioning of the Appian custom resource definition. This allows evolving the schema for Appian custom resources without breaking backward compatibility.
    • Webhook certificates are now required and externally managed. This enables customers to manage certificates in a wider variety of ways. Customers can still use cert-manager to handle their certificates if they were using it previously.

    Note:  Upgrading the operator to the new version will require manual action on the customer to either externally manage their own certificates or configure cert-manager to inject the CA bundle. Please refer to our documentation for more information prior to upgrading.

  • Added new API version v1beta1 to the Appian CRD. The following changes have been made in v1beta1:
    • Removed deprecated field .spec.webapp.dataSources.validationQuery. In order to configure a validation query in v1beta1, use the .spec.webapp.dataSources.attributes field.
    • .spec.webapp.url is now moved to .spec.url
  • Added support for replicas, pod disruption budgets, and horizontal pod autoscaling for the operator's webhooks.

  • In previous operator versions, the user had the responsibility of manually managing the Appian Data Server security token and Service Manager admin user credentials. Now the operator conveniently manages these internally. As a result of this change, if customers are creating custom resources without the Service Manager auth secret name, Service Manager will restart.
    • This also means that the following secret fields have now been deprecated.
      • .spec.dataServer.securityTokenSecretName
      • .spec.serviceManager.auth

Deprecations

The features listed below are deprecated and will be removed in future releases. Do not begin using deprecated features, and transition away from any prior usage of now deprecated features. Where applicable, supported alternatives are described for each deprecation.

  • The field .spec.webapp.dataSources.validationQuery in the CRD is now deprecated, use .spec.webapp.dataSources.attributes to configure a validation query instead.
  • The field .spec.webapp.url in the CRD is now deprecated, use .spec.url instead.
  • Secret fields previously exposed in the CRD .spec.dataServer.securityTokenSecretName and .spec.serviceManager.auth are now deprecated. The operator will take on the responsibility of managing the secrets.
